What Software Was Used To Create Everlater?

Feld Thoughts

Everlater is built on Ruby on Rails , postgreSQL and is hosted on Engine Yard using a passenger/nginx combination. Nate and Natty use several standard Ruby/Rails packages (gems) to extend the base functionality of Rails. Now that you know how they got started, here’s what they ended up choosing.

How To Find A Programmer To Build Your Startup Idea

socialmatchbox.com

Another option is sweat equity. It is important to realize that most people who are willing to work for sweat equity are not a) the best, b) in demand, and c) going to put their heart and soul into your project. Motivation to work for sweat equity is something else that founders tend to take for granted.

Can A Startup Do OffShore Development? Part 2

prosperati.com

The Ruby community in Kuala Lumpur is fairly small. As a result, most people in Malaysia are not familiar with stock options or equity participation. Spare no expense to find the absolute best person for this role. The cliches of hiring the best of the best is as true in Malaysia as it is in the US.
